The Health, Safety Association of New Zealand (HASANZ) every year offers four scholarship categories that are aimed at individuals who are currently working in health and safety, as well as those who wish to pursue a career in this field.

 

 

 

The four scholarship categories are:

Health & Safety – For practitioners and health and safety representatives looking to upskill to a diploma or degree. This category also supports those wanting to specialise by pursuing a bachelor’s or postgraduate qualification at a university.

Poutama – For Māori health and safety practitioners who want to advance their skills and grow their impact in the field.

Women in Safety – For female practitioners ready to move from technical roles into leadership and governance, helping shape health and safety practices across Aotearoa.

Agriculture & Horticulture – Designed to attract people to careers in agriculture and horticulture, and support specialisation through relevant qualifications. While there is a focus on the Bay of Plenty region, applications are welcome from all locations.

HASANZ has compiled a handy guide to tertiary workplace health and safety courses(external link) in New Zealand and Australia. This list is a helpful starting point, for those looking for available courses. However, applications to study other tertiary qualifications in workplace health and safety that aren’t featured on this list are also accepted.
